Consumption is influenced by many factors: speed, outside temperature, heating, air conditioning, seat heating and battery conditioning. Since statistics are weighted by kilometres driven, a single 200 km motorway trip in summer at 100 km/h has more influence on the average than ten short city trips.

EPA = official US manufacturer rating (Combined). Real consumption is based on user data from EV Monitor.
EPA ratings are tested under US conditions and tend to be closer to real-world consumption than WLTP.
